Can Radeon RX 7600 run Steel Judgment?
GreatThe Radeon RX 7600 handles Steel Judgment well at 1080p, delivering approximately 286 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 214 FPS.
Steel Judgment – Radeon RX 7600 F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 447 fps | 335 fps | 179 fps |
| Medium | 357 fps | 268 fps | 143 fps |
| High | 286 fps | 214 fps | 114 fps |
| Ultra | 232 fps | 174 fps | 93 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

About
Steel Judgment is designed to be accessible, making it suitable for gamers with entry-level GPUs like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T. These graphics cards can handle the game at 1080p resolution with medium settings, providing a smooth experience during the fast-paced action. For players looking to enjoy better visuals or higher frame rates, a mid-range GPU such as the RTX 3060 or RX 6600 will allow for high settings at 1080p or even 1440p with decent performance.
The game is not particularly demanding, allowing a broad range of players to join in on the chaotic fun. With a minimum of 4 GB of RAM, it should run efficiently on most modern systems. For an optimal experience, aim for a setup with at least 8 GB of RAM and a solid mid-tier GPU, which will ensure you can fully enjoy the dynamic combat and diverse gameplay mechanics. Overall, Steel Judgment is recommended for both casual and more serious gamers looking for a fun, fast-paced experience without needing high-end hardware.
